安卓:复制/粘贴栏被软键盘推出屏幕

3
当我在我的EditText上双击一个单词时,复制/粘贴栏会显示出来。这很好。问题是复制/粘贴栏出现在屏幕外面了。似乎是被软键盘顶上去了。请看截图。
我的问题是:如何使复制/粘贴栏固定不动呢?
我在清单文件中使用了"adjustPan"。
2个回答

2

最终我找到了解决方法。也许对其他人有帮助...

  1. 在Manifest中使用adjustResize而非adjustPan
  2. 将xml布局包裹在一个ScrollView
  3. 同时为EditText指定一个android:minHeight

如果主视图为RelativeLayout,这种方法可能不起作用。因此,最好使用LinearLayout或FrameLayout等其他视图。

=)


0

我曾经遇到过同样的问题。我在清单文件中使用了android:windowSoftInputMode="adjustNothing",希望这个方法能够解决问题。因为adjustResizeadjustPan都没有解决我的问题。


网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接